Garden Update 1

We've got a few new additions to the Cucina di Campo Chef's Garden. Just planted Jalapeno Peppers and another pepper, either Serano or Habanero. The plant tag said Serano, my intended choice, but upon transplanting to its new container I noticed the container tag said Habanero. We are all hoping for Seranos; many of our summer salsas contain this perfectly hot pepper. Habaneros have an excellent flavor, very fruity, but are almost too hot to use in our salsas.

Also planted Dill, another favorite herb. Excellent for the salmon recipe posted earlier, and should help deter the aphids and other flying insects the Marigolds can't keep up with.
